| 1 | | SENATE RESOLUTION
|
| 2 | | WHEREAS, The members of the Illinois Senate are saddened |
| 3 | | to learn of the death of Aaron Odom, who passed away on June |
| 4 | | 15, 2021; and
|
| 5 | | WHEREAS, Aaron Odom was born in Tunica, Mississippi to |
| 6 | | Leon and Ellen Odom on June 26, 1954; as a child, he was known |
| 7 | | for his exceptional academic aptitude and excelled in both |
| 8 | | math and science; he attended Penn Elementary School and |
| 9 | | Farragut High School; he was a star athlete throughout his |
| 10 | | high school and college careers; and
|
| 11 | | WHEREAS, Aaron Odom was called into the ministry in the |
| 12 | | late 1980s; he was ordained as an elder under the leadership of |
| 13 | | the late Bishop William Haven Bonner of the Illinois Sixth |
| 14 | | Ecclesiastical Jurisdiction in 2004; he was concerned and |
| 15 | | passionate about sharing the gospel; he was known for always |
| 16 | | offering an immediate prayer when requested and for being an |
| 17 | | eloquent orator; as an associate minister, he consistently |
| 18 | | taught Bible study and preached Sunday morning service at The |
| 19 | | Potter's House Christian Church; and
|
| 20 | | WHEREAS, Aaron Odom was known for his sense of humor, |
| 21 | | quick wit, wisdom, intellect, faith, and love for his family; |
| 22 | | he was passionate about sports throughout his life, and he |
